Is it better to turbo or supercharge a V8?

While the turbo’s primary drawback is boost lag, the supercharger’s is efficiency. Because a supercharger uses the engine’s own power to spin itself, it siphons power—more and more of it as engine revs climb. Supercharged engines tend to be less fuel efficient for this reason.

What are the reasons why supercharging increase engine power?

A supercharger is an air compressor that increases the pressure or density of air supplied to an internal combustion engine. This gives each intake cycle of the engine more oxygen, letting it burn more fuel and do more work, thus increasing power.

Why do automakers use supercharging and turbocharging?

The earliest and most common reason automakers look to supercharging and turbocharging is to get more power out of an existing engine. In 2009, Chevrolet introduced the ZR1 Corvette with a 6.2-liter supercharged V8 making 638 horsepower. The standard Corvette used a naturally aspirated version of the same engine that produced 430 horsepower.

Does Volvo have a supercharger?

Volvo currently offers an engine that uses both a turbocharger and supercharger, called twincharging. The supercharger provides boost at low engine speeds such as from a stop, and the turbocharger comes in at higher RPMs, like when passing at highway speeds.

What are the downsides of a supercharger?

On the downside, there’s usually a small percentage of power loss from the engine to gain the power benefits from a supercharger. In the end, however, any losses are generally far overwhelmed by increased engine output. They, too, display a unique sound often described as a distinct whine.

What cars have turbocharged engines?

Lancia and Nissan made use of both turbocharging and supercharging in rally cars from the 1980s. A few years later, Volkswagen released a car that utilized a twin-charged 1.4-liter engine that produced as much power as a 2.3-liter engine but with a twenty-percent improvement in fuel economy.
